Describe about the Lysosomes enzymes
Within the cytoplasm of the cell, several hydrolytic enzymes (lytic enzymes) capable of hydrolysing proteins, nucleic acids and carbohydrates, are present within specialised membrane bound vesicles called the lysosomes. Some 40 enzymes are known to be present within lysosomes and some of these include acid phosphatase, cathepsins and nucleases. The lysosomes are actually formed by budding from the Golgi bodies. Their main function appears to be involved in the selective breakdown of cellular macromolecules within the cytoplasm. The lytic enzymes are thus, especially contained within these bag-like structures so that indiscriminate hydrolysis of substances is prevented. Lysosomes are abundant in leucocytes (white blood cells) that ingest invading microorganisms
